E
Ethan Pikas Review of Genyx solar power
I recently had a solar power system installed by G...
I recently had a solar power system installed by Genyx and I am extremely satisfied with the results. The team was professional and the installation process was seamless. I highly recommend Genyx to anyone considering switching to solar power.
Comments: